Freeflow Ventures is an early-stage venture capital firm founded in 2019 and based in Berkeley, California. The firm has invested in over 30 companies, focusing on deep tech solutions that leverage artificial intelligence and machine learning. Their portfolio includes startups in sectors such as healthcare, biotech, and climate.
Freeflow Ventures invests in early-stage companies across pre-seed, seed, Series A, and Series B funding rounds. Their investment strategy emphasizes deep tech solutions in human health and planetary health, targeting industries like biomanufacturing, drug discovery, medical devices, and carbon capture. The firm seeks to support science-driven founders who utilize advanced technologies to tackle significant challenges.
Notable portfolio companies include Iambic Therapeutics, a platform for small-molecule drug discovery using physics-informed AI; StrokeDx, which innovates stroke diagnosis with non-invasive imaging technology; Hydrosat, providing geospatial intelligence for food security via satellite imagery; and Captura, developing systems for large-scale carbon dioxide capture from ocean water.
